Project Managing

This is basically the current design, with a few changes.

For each project, there are three extra things: A version number, a “What's New” box, and a subscribe button. You can subscribe to see when it is updated (If you are subscribed to the creator you are told automatically).

For updating it, it is simple. When you share it, and you modify it and save it, an “Update” button pops up. You can click it and it will share the new version (prompting you to update the version number and “What's New.” It will notify subscribers to both the creator and the project. That way, someone can tell when something new is added, and problems such as saving something that breaks the app can be avoided.

Of course, the whole “version number” and “update” thing can be turned off for newer Scratchers, and it will simply notify subscribers when you save a change.
